What are the Advantages of Using Spectrophotometry in Epidemiological Studies?

The advantages of using spectrophotometry in epidemiological studies include:
- High sensitivity and specificity in detecting and quantifying analytes
- Rapid processing of multiple samples
- Non-invasive sample collection methods
- Ability to measure a wide range of substances
These benefits make spectrophotometry an invaluable tool for large-scale public health research and disease monitoring.
